July 19, 2023 - World-renowned South Korean directors, including Park Chan-wook and Bong Joon Ho, cite Kim Ki-young as being the greatest Korean influence on their work. When Yuh-Jung Youn won the best supporting actress award at the 2021 Oscars, she thanked Kim Ki-young, the “genius” director of the first film she starred in, 1971's Woman of Fire. During his thirty year career, Kim Ki-young produced thirty-three films and became revered by critics within the national and international community as one of the few South Korean ‘auteurs'. As the first comprehensive scholarly volume on Kim Ki-young in English, ReFocus: The Films of Kim Ki-young covers his entire career and history of cinematic work, highlighting the thematic and stylistic singularity of Kim's oeuvre, which was produced relative to the specific historical and cultural conditions of post-war South Korea. It offers an innovative departure point from which to explore South Korean film relative to the wider history of world cinema, in addition to situating Kim's work within the broader fields of Korean modern history, transnational cinema and cultural studies. Rok 2003 był wyjątkowy dla kina koreańskiego. Że dzieje się tam coś niezwykłego i ekscytującego było wiadomo już od paru lat. Lokalne filmy stawały się coraz lepsze, widzowie z dumą ciągnęli do kin. Rząd i prywatni inwestorzy wyłożyli na stół duże pieniądze, które producenci odważnie inwestowali w ryzykowne projekty. Nowe pokolenie artystów mogło dzięki temu eksperymentować z językiem filmowym, przepracowując jednocześnie traumy dorastania w zmiennych i niespokojnych latach 80. i 90. Sezon 2003 wystartował przeciętnie, ale koło kwietnia wszystko się odwróciło. Obiecujące młode trio - Bong Joon-ho, Park Chan-wook i Kim Jee-woon pokazało swoje pierwsze arcydzieła. Wkrótce o "Zagadce zbrodni", "Old Boyu" i "Opowieści o dwóch siostrach" mówiono nie tylko w Seulu czy Busan, ale także w Cannes, Nowym Jorku i w Warszawie. Było to kino piękne wizualnie, gwałtowne emocjonalnie, głębokie w znaczenia. A istotnych filmów było znacznie więcej. "Wiosna, lato, jesień, zima... i wiosna" Kim Ki-duka stała się hitem eksportowym; "Uratować zieloną planetę!" poniosło klęskę w kinach, ale dzisiaj jest uznawane za najbardziej szaloną jazdę w historii Nowego Kina Koreańskiego; na koniec roku odbyła się premiera superwidowiska "Silmido", pierwszego lokalnego filmu z ponad dziesięcio milionową widownią. Dzisiaj rok ten jawi się jako czas niezwykłej kreatywności, radości burzenia starych reguł kina popularnego, formowania się najlepszej kinematografii XXI wieku. 20 lat później przemysł ten jest już zupełnie inny - znacznie dojrzalszy, bezpieczniejszy i przez to mniej ekscytujący. Zapraszamy na opowieść o najważniejszych filmach koreańskich, które właśnie obchodzą 20 urodziny.

The Korean War is aptly known in America as the “Forgotten War.” During the 1960s, the subject took in its last cinematic hurrah before getting overshadowed by the rising unpopularity of America's involvement in the Vietnam War. Meanwhile, South Korea was experiencing a fabled “Golden Age” of cinema that followed the civil war and continued into the ‘60s – one that had some of its most famous hits rather cruelly lost to time. At Cinema60, we've largely ignored the Combat Film genre on whole… until now! In this episode, Bart and Jenna take the opportunity to dig a little deeper into the war and “Golden Age” that time forgot. Watching three American films about the Korean War side-by-side with three films from South Korea on the same subject, they parse propaganda from profundity, patriotism from personal morality, and savagery from psychosis from two different nationalistic perspectives. https://notesonfilm1.com/2022/05/21/thinking-aloud-about-film-the-housemaid-kim-ki-young-south-korea-1960/ We continue with our discussion of the MARTIN SCORSESE'S WORLD CINEMA strand on MUBI, this time focusing on Kim Ki-young's THE HOUSEMAID (South Korea, 1960). MUBI's take is that it influenced Bong Joon-ho's PARASITE – clearly evident – and that it ‘changed the course of South Korean cinema forever. An immense success when released in 1960, this striking masterpiece is a blend of sexual obsession and class struggle, horror and social critique'. In the podcast, we agree with most of what MUBI says about it but question the claim that it's a masterpiece,' finding the film deeply misogynistic in ways that go even beyond the patriarchal norms of its time and culture. The very handsome version being screened by MUBI is the 2008 restoration by the Korean Film Archive and is a real pleasure to see, making visible the film's very real inventiveness with light, composition and movement.

El ciclo de la vida de Kim Ki Duk. En su film más depurado, utiliza las estaciones del año en paralelo a la infancia, la juventud, la madurez y la vejez. Con una idílica escenografía que exalta los sentidos, el monje y su discípulo viven en un pequeño templo aislado en medio de un lago, entre montañas y barrancos. En este bucólico enclave reinan los silencios más que los diálogos, y la música de viento incrementa la sensación de bienestar y serenidad. El desapego del maestro, la negación del ego y su observación de los errores naturales del monje joven, es natural el deseo ante la mujer recién llegada, Un film imbuído de filosofía budista, de ascetismo y respeto a todas las formas de vida. De hecho el dolor que el crío causa a los animales será una piedra en su espalda, siempre la cargará , y así se lo hace saber su maestro en una especie de maldición. Un maestro muy castigador para ser budista. Kim Ki Duk introduce gran cantidad de simbolismos, los animales, el perro -la niñez, la inocencia-, el gallo – la juventud, la valentía y la lujuria-, el gato -la edad adulta, la calidez y la independencia-, la tortuga, la serpiente, cada uno representa virtudes, defectos y sentimientos, las dos puertas, entrada sin paredes en medio del agua, el libre albedrío y la disciplina, o la humilde barca y sus remos, el vehículo hacia el buen o el mal viaje. El director de "Seom", "Samaritan Girl" y "Hierro 3" nunca fue budista y arrima a su cosmogonía particular los errores cometidos del aprendiz, las heridas profundas, el peso del pecado, la ira y el odio, un suicidio fallido, o el deseo de posesión. Ya lo dice el maestro, la lujuria causa el ansia de poseer, y el deseo de poseer causa el deseo de matar. Hay que romper las ataduras que nos causan el sufrimiento. . Difundida durante décadas en pobrísimas copias y al borde de la desaparición, The Housemaid llegó a convertirse en una suerte de mito del cine coreano y asiático gracias al desbordante conflicto entre una empleada puertas adentro y sus patrones, que parte en clave de drama social para derivar a escenarios de delirio y terror. ¿Cómo hizo Kim Ki-young para dirigir este filme alucinado en un país que al poco andar caería en dictadura? ¿En qué estaban los durísimos censores locales que la dejaron pasar bajo sus narices? Comparada frecuentemente con las sátiras de Buñuel, admirada por un Scorsese que la rescató a través de su Film Foundation e inspiración directa en la creación de la aplaudida Parasite, nada en The Housemaid parece haber envejecido lo suficiente como para hacerla perder su feroz mirada sobre los enfrentamientos de clase, las grietas de la masculinidad y los espejismos del desarrollo económico-social. In this week's episode of Me, You and Jeju, Darryl Coote and Alexis Oesterle discuss the passing of Kim Ki-hong, a transgender activist and politician on Jeju Island. Ki-hong organized the Jeju Queer Festival, ran as a politician for the Green Party and was an outspoken activist for LGBTQ+ rights not only on the island but in Korea. Ze died by suicide two weeks ago and his passing has been felt throughout the nation. However, Ki-hong was one of three members of South Korea's transgender community to die by suicide in the past few weeks, and Seoul-based freelance journalist Raphael Rashid sat down with Darryl and Alexis to discuss issues currently affecting this marginalized group.
